Madden NFL 21 offers strategic gameplay, requiring players to develop problem-solving skills, spatial awareness, and quick reaction times. The career mode provides a sense of progression and achievement.

The game incorporates significant dopamine manipulation mechanics, such as variable rewards and escalating commitment, which can encourage excessive play. Its monetization strategy, including microtransactions and potential pay-to-win elements, may pressure players to spend money to remain competitive. While lacking direct stranger chat, the competitive online environment can expose players to social comparison and potential toxicity.
